SAG mill control fundamentally means managing the load in the mill by adjusting the feed rate of ore to the mill and/or manipulating the rotational speed of the mill. The best way to measure load is to mount the mill on load cells. The load cells are calibrated to measure the total weight of water grinding media (balls) and ore in the mill

Chat OnlineA load cell is a type of transducer specifically a force transducer. It converts a force such as tension compression pressure or torque into an electrical signal that can be measured and standardized. As the force applied to the load cell increases the electrical signal changes proportionally.

Chat OnlineTypically a SAG mill weight measurement by either bearing pressure transducers or load cells is used as an inferred measurement of volumetric filling. To maintain volumetric filling within a set operating range the SAG weight setpoint use for process control requires regular review due to changes in SAG mill charge density (rock ball ratio
